This year saw a total of close to forty players participating in the popular sport of badminton. While one does not ordinarily think of badminton when we hear such words as speed, agility, finesse and endurance, it is these qualities that build the foundation of great badminton. We had our share of top-ranking players as well as those who had never played of all, and it mode for a fine group of athletes. Although we had only one competitive tournament against other schools at the beginning of the season, that did not stop us from holding inter-squad tournaments on a bi-weekly basis. One of the nice things about badminton is that there are several tiers in which one can play: singles, doubles, and mixed doubles. We incorporated each of these into our tournaments and, overall, had a very successful season.
